Biripal village is located in the Kankadahad Tehsil of the Dhenkanal district in Odisha .
Block / Tehsil → Kankadahad
District → Dhenkanal
State → Odisha
According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Biripal village is 759028.
Biripal village has a total population of 36 people, of which 17 are males and 19 are females.
The literacy rate of Biripal village is 33.33%. Male literacy stands at 41.18% and female literacy at 26.32%.
There are approximately 9 households in Biripal village.
Kamakshyanagar (38 km) is the nearest town to Biripal village for major economic activities and is located approximately 38 km away.
The population of Biripal village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 7 | 5 | 12 |
| Illiterate | 10 | 14 | 24 |
| Total | 17 | 19 | 36 |
Source: Census 2011
